About the role
Domain area-focused architect responsible for defining solutions that align to enterprise strategies and standards. Act as a critical interface between business Stakeholders and Technology Teams to translate business intent into viable technology solutions that enable desired business outcomes.
Responsibilities
- Partner with Technology Teams to establish an architecture that meets SWA technology standards
- Partner with business & technology Stakeholders to establish the technical strategy/roadmap for a business domain product(s) or product line(s)
- Operate as a trusted advisor for the business, work to define the business intent and non-functional requirements, and provide a comprehensive architecture that will meet business needs
- Contribute to the growth of the SWA Technology Teams through hiring, coaching, and mentoring
- Promote architecture technology standards and contribute to SWA technology standards
- Research current and emerging technologies and identify technologies that can accelerate business value delivery
- Seek opportunities to improve SWA technical competency actively
- Design, build, refactor or operate distributed large scale and impactful IT projects - either on premises or in the cloud
Requirements
- Knowledge of a modern programming language (e.g. Python, JavaScript, Go, .Net, Java, etc.)
- Knowledge of working in a technology domain such as distributed large-scale web, mobile applications, APIs, Cloud, Event Streams, DevOps, Serverless, Big Data, and Analytics
- Skilled in excellent verbal and written communication with Stakeholders to achieve the desired architectural outcomes
- Ability to use logic and reasoning to identify the strengths and weaknesses of alternative solutions, conclusions or approaches to problems
- Ability to understand and apply information to contribute to the organization’s strategic plan
- Ability to bring others together and trying to reconcile differences
- Ability to understand the implications of new information for both current and future problem-solving and decision-making
- Skilled in Architecture Design Tools (e.g. Draw.io, Visio)
- Skilled in Software programming paradigms (e.g. Object orientated, Functional)
- Skilled in Software versioning software and best practices (e.g. Git)
